Von Duprin - D9914633

Von Duprin - D9914633

Product Description

D9914633 - El99Dt Us26D 3'

Contact for Pricing

SKU IT292409

Featured Items

Similar Items

Best Sellers

Additional Description

D9914633 - El99Dt Us26D 3'

BROWSE STORE BY: